Essential Selection & Care Instructions
1. Red Amaryllis for Holiday Drama
Amaryllis bulbs produce massive, trumpet-shaped red flowers that make stunning holiday centerpieces. Gifting a potted amaryllis bulb allows the recipient to watch the flower grow and bloom throughout winter.
2. Poinsettias: The Traditional Holiday Plant
Poinsettias are the official plant of Christmas. Their bright red bracts (modified leaves) add instant festive cheer. Choose plants with healthy dark green lower leaves and yellow buds in the center.
3. Winter Foliage and Pinecone Accents
Incorporate seasonal pine branch sprigs, cedar, and frosted pinecones into your holiday arrangements. They add texture and release a fresh winter pine scent that fills the room.

⚠️ Critical Holiday Pet Poison Warnings
Amaryllis, holly berries, and mistletoe are highly toxic to cats and dogs. Poinsettias are mildly toxic, causing mouth irritation and drooling. Keep all holiday plants out of pet reach.
